CCC WEEKLY RELEASE

BEVERLY, Mass. – Endicott senior shortstop/third baseman Mike Kochiss (Fairfield, Conn.) has been named the Commonwealth Coast Conference (CCC) Player of the Week, as announced by the league office earlier today.

Kochiss, who is the reigning CCC Player of the Year, batted .609 last week with a 1.000 slugging percentage as Endicott went 3-3 in non-conference play. The senior had hits in each of the Gulls' six games, including five multi-hit performances. He also scored at least one run in five of the six games. His biggest game of the week came in a 14-7 win against Rutgers-Camden in which he went 4-for-5 with five runs scored and two RBI. He also had two doubles and a home run in that contest.

Overall, Kochiss scored 12 runs and drove in five, while hitting four doubles, a triple, and a home run. The senior infielder was also part of a triple play in Endicott's first game against UMass-Dartmouth.
